My mother due to diabetic complications developed stage 3a kidney decease. Though her A1C is at 7.5 now, earlier it is around 10. I am attaching her current lab results. CREATININE: 1.2 EFGR (estimated glomerular filtration rate) : 51.3 ALBUMIN CREATINE RATIO 38.5 Is there any ayurveda medicines that will cure/stop further progress. My mother also developed diabetic nuropathy. Some one gave punarnava arista, ashoka arista, saraswathi arista and some other powders. She took for 4 months. Earlier she can't do even household work also. She is better now as she is able to perform household work. Please give medications for both Stage 3a Kidney decease and Nuropathy.

Hello dear, of course Ayurveda can help your mother to recover from her current medical condition. It is encouraging to see your mother’s A1C drop from 10 to 7.5, and her functional recovery following the initial Arishta regimen is a highly positive clinical sign. The restoration of her ability to manage household work indicates a very good response to the Vata-anulomana and Sroto-shodhana properties of those initial formulations. ​To address the expectation of a “cure,” it is important to ground the approach in clinical reality. Stage 3a Chronic Kidney Disease secondary to diabetes (Diabetic Nephropathy) involves structural changes to the glomeruli. Neither modern medicine nor Ayurveda can completely “cure” or reverse this existing structural damage. However, targeted Ayurvedic intervention is highly effective at halting further progression, preserving her current eGFR of 51.3, reducing the albumin-creatinine ratio, and managing neuropathic symptoms. Diabetic Nephropathy and Neuropathy are classic manifestations of Prameha Upadrava. The persistent Kapha-Pitta dushti in Prameha eventually leads to significant Vata prakopa and Avarana. In the kidneys (Vrukka and Mutravaha Srotas), this manifests as functional impairment and protein leakage (Kleda accumulation and Dhatu Kshaya). In the peripheral nerves, the Vata vitiation causes Supti (numbness) and Daha (burning sensation).
